AI and Automation Redefine Manufacturing Dynamics

The latest insights from the March/April 2026 issue of Plant Engineering highlight a pivotal shift in the manufacturing sector, where artificial intelligence (AI) and automation are increasingly shaping operational strategies. This evolution is critical as industries strive to bridge the gap between current capabilities and market demands.

What Happened
The issue delves into several key areas of interest for manufacturing professionals, emphasizing the need for proper valve lubrication to ensure operational reliability and prevent costly downtimes. It also explores the financial implications of valve corrosion and the necessity for maintenance professionals to understand the role of valves and seals in compressed air systems. Beyond maintenance, the publication underscores the transformative impact of AI and machine learning (ML) in industrial plant engineering. As manufacturers face frequent product changeovers, automation is becoming a crucial tool in optimizing production time and costs. The issue also covers essential fall protection equipment inspections and the ongoing debate between AI-driven and in-person learning methods.
